Instead of theory, here are real results.

Last week, I sold 21 items for a total of $1,761, sourced from a mix of estate sales and online auctions. This breakdown shows exactly what sold, where it was sourced, and why this matters if you’re building or scaling a reselling side hustle.

If you want proof that reselling works across many categories — this is it.


Quick Breakdown: Where the Inventory Came From

  • Estate Sale Purchases (E): Majority of items
  • Online Purchases (O): Select specialty and niche items

This combination allows for:

  • Lower cost of goods (estate sales)
  • Strategic niche sourcing (online)
  • Consistent weekly sales without relying on one source

Items That Sold Last Week

🎮 Electronics, Media & Vintage Tech

  • 1963 Whitman The Aristocrat of Money Stock Market Game – Complete (E)
  • Panasonic Omnivision 4-Head Hi-Fi VCR w/ Remote & Cables (E)
  • Sony SLV-N88 Hi-Fi VCR VHS Recorder w/ Remote & Cables (E)
  • JVC HR-A47U Pro-Cision 4-Head VCR VHS Player/Recorder (E)
  • Lowrance Elite-5X DSI Fishfinder GPS Head Unit (E)
  • Nikon COOLPIX L24 14MP Digital Camera (E)
  • Canon Sure Shot 76 Zoom 35mm Film Camera w/ Case (O)

📌 Why these sell:
Vintage electronics, VCRs, film cameras, and GPS/fishfinder units continue to have strong resale demand, especially when tested or clearly described.


🔧 Automotive, Marine & Industrial Equipment

  • OTC 3398 EFI Tester – Electronic Fuel Injection Tester (E)
  • Power Steering Pump Assembly – Honda Accord 2.4L (E)
  • Schumacher SC1363 Battery Charger & Maintainer 8A (E)
  • Schumacher SE-82-6 Dual Rate Battery Charger (E)
  • SeaStar SSC13412 Rack & Pinion Steering Cable – Marine (O)
  • 4x137mm Wheel Spacers – ATV/UTV Applications (O)

📌 Why these sell:
Automotive, marine, and industrial tools are high-value, low-competition categories. Buyers are often professionals or serious hobbyists willing to pay for the right part.


🎸 Musical Instruments & Hobby Items

  • Roland Micro Cube Red Guitar Amplifier (E)

📌 Why this sells:
Compact guitar amps and branded music gear move quickly, even when listed “as-is” with clear descriptions.


🏠 Home, Health & Lifestyle Products

  • AirHood Portable Air Cleaner Fan Range AH-01AE (E)
  • Professional Nail Dust Collector – 1600PA Portable (O)
  • Delta In2ition 2-in-1 Shower Head (O)

📌 Why these sell:
Home improvement and personal care items sell well year-round and are often overlooked at estate sales.


👟 Clothing, Shoes & Media

  • Nike Cortez Basic Leather ‘06 – Size 12 (E)
  • Thru the Bible Radio – McGee 20-CD Set (E)

📌 Why these sell:
Specific shoe models and boxed media sets still perform well when condition and size/demand line up.


Key Takeaways From This Week’s Sales

✅ Reselling Works Across Many Categories

You don’t need to niche down immediately. Electronics, tools, shoes, media, and home items can all coexist in one store.

✅ Estate Sales Still Dominate for Value

Most of the higher-margin items came from estate sales, proving they remain one of the best sourcing options for resellers.

✅ Online Sourcing Fills Strategic Gaps

Online purchases work well for:

  • Specialty parts
  • Hard-to-find components
  • Items you can’t source locally

✅ Condition Isn’t Everything — Clarity Is

Several items sold with notes like “untested” or “read description”. Honest listings reduce returns and still attract buyers.
